Sedlak Gets Short and Doubles
Level 27
: 8,000/16,000, 16,000 ante
Following a flop of 8♣8♠7♠, Martin Sedlak checked and Stephen Song bet 25,000. Sedlak check-raised to 70,000 and then quickly folded when Song jammed with the covering stack.
"Nut flush draw, easy decision," Song said and Sedlak replied "you were ahead."
"I had ace five of spades and decided to see the flop," Song added.
One hand later, Sedlak open-shoved for the last 135,000 in an early position and Nevan Chang called in the next seat while everyone else folded.
Martin Sedlak: Q♦Q♥
Nevan Chang: K♣Q♣
The 7♥7♠5♠A♠9♦ board delivered no clubs or kings for Sedlak to survive.
